This beer pours an extremely clear yellow color with a medium white head and leaves very little lace on the glass. There was a little wheat in the aroma, but it wasn't very strong. The flavor was a very mild wheat taste, but there was a nice bit of malt and there was also some fruityness in there as well.

Another filtered "American" wheat - my taste buds were prepared for boredom. But, what's this? Some fruit in the aroma. And, wonder of wonders - flavor! At first, while still quite cold, it is tart, almost to the point of being a Berliner, but evened out at the finish with some fruit flavors. As it warmed, the tartness settled down and some malty wheat flavors picked up, with some apple and brown sugar. One of the better summer wheats I've run across.

This is really a gorgeous beer with probably the cleanest, most brilliant straw golden color I've ever seen, forming a rocky picket-fence white head that stays nicely atop medium bubbles and delicate lace. Well carbonated with spiral streams of bubbles. Aroma is very nice and well balanced with notes of sweet malt, sparse yet spicy hops, extremely clean fermentation with crisp, mineralized water. Mouthfeel is crisp and refreshing with a light body. Taste starts out with a crisp, soft yet spicy Cascade hop flavor, fading into a well-balanced pale malt backbone, a very clean ferment with no off-flavors, refreshingly crisp mineralized water, and ending in a subtle yet lingering toasty wheat sweetness with a faint mild bitter hop to balance it. A remarkably well-balanced beer and probably the best American Wheat I've had to date (Better than Sierra Nevada Wheat IMO). Perfect for summer cookouts and beach days, but perfectly enjoyable on a cold winter night here in Michigan.

Very light clear straw colored brew. Thin white head laces nicely. A pungent aroma exists and not much else. Taste is very average. Very clean and refreshing type of a beer. Wheat is present in seemingly very small quantities. Some slight hop spiciness. Body is about light-medium. Nice amont of carbonation. No bad off-flavors here, but nothing to shout about. I could see drinking a few of these if it were very hot and no other good options were around.
